Kai-Fu Lee is a scholar working on Artificial Intelligence, Signal Processing and Biomedical Engineering. According to data from OpenAlex, Kai-Fu Lee has authored 16 papers receiving a total of 518 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Artificial Intelligence, 8 papers in Signal Processing and 1 paper in Biomedical Engineering. Recurrent topics in Kai-Fu Lee’s work include Speech Recognition and Synthesis (11 papers), Speech and Audio Processing (7 papers) and Natural Language Processing Techniques (5 papers). Kai-Fu Lee is often cited by papers focused on Speech Recognition and Synthesis (11 papers), Speech and Audio Processing (7 papers) and Natural Language Processing Techniques (5 papers). Kai-Fu Lee collaborates with scholars based in United States, United Kingdom and Switzerland. Kai-Fu Lee's co-authors include Sanjoy Mahajan, Hsiao-Wuen Hon, Mei-Yuh Hwang, Xuedong Huang, Roni Rosenfeld, F. Alleva, Eric Chang, Chao Huang, Jian-Lai Zhou and Evelyne Bischof and has published in prestigious journals such as Nature Biotechnology, The Journal of the Acoustical Society of America and Artificial Intelligence.
